Transaction 6134100c806711e6ca02d03236d195f0a651597a8ab1eb40ecdcb391c4cbdf1e
1 Input
1 Output
-
6134100c806711e6ca02d03236d195f0a651597a8ab1eb40ecdcb391c4cbdf1e:0
- value
- 38326481
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f13e629ae6c91a9956a4700d48af250533575f77 OP_EQUAL
- address
- 3PgbWNajC5PzMygiZBF2nwPtZGFzAEgT8w